Pistons and Rings
Building a 400 block, 4" stroke for the street but also planning on doing some open road racing. Might even try the Texas Mile or something similar. I do plan on driving this car a LOT. Trying to make some decisions on pistons and rings. It will have a Canton pan with the kickouts on both sides. I was thinking of using the Motion Raceworks catch can with breather tubes from both covers going into it to let it breathe. I called Total Seal and the guy told me either 1.5mm top and 2nd, or .043" top and 2nd and go with a 3/16" oil ring. He also said to use a gapless and gas ported ring. My intention is to have custom pistons made from 4032, coated, and maybe DLC coated pins. I want to make decent power and make it for thousands of miles. So longevity is important to me. Any thoughts?
In case you're curious...4.145" bore, Oliver 6.8 rods, KRE 290cfm CNC D-ports, Hyd roller w/ solids 234/[email protected] w/ .560" lift on a 112 lsa. RPM intake and an 800 cfm Q-jet. Planning on backing it up with a Tremec TKX and 3.50 gears out back. |

I had Total Seal gapless rings in my 455 motor, the leakdown rate was less then 2% ran great but had a lot of reversion. I removed them when I refreshed the engine and the reversion went away. I was using a header evac system. Perhaps if I had vacuum pump it may have eliminated the reversion. I think gapless rings may work better with a vacuum pump.

We use thin ring packs all the time. It's a great way to add modern technology to our beloved Pontiac engines. Machining quality, finish and assembly become more important when using thin rings. They are a win-win at our shop. More power, less friction, less bore wear.

I've built a few motors with the thin "LS" rings - no problems.
Back in the late 90's I used a set of the Total Gapless 2nd rings. They were basically an iron ring with a groove for 2nd ring (like an oil scraper ring) and you stagger the end gaps. I'm not sure if they even make those anymore, a gapless top ring makes much more sense to me. Anyway, that motor lasted maybe a year, and it was burning oil. One (maybe two, it's been a while) of the gapless rings had cracked. They also had nothing to keep the rings from rotating (maybe they've addressed that issue with their newer rings) and several of the other had rotated so that the gaps were aligned (so no longer "gapless"). |
